Assessment and Planning
Our team will begin by assessing the extent of the water damage, using spec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the source of the leak. We'll then create a customized plan to address the damage and restore your floors to their original condition.
Water Extraction
Next, we'll use industrial-grade pumps to extract the standing water from your floors, reducing the risk of further damage and health hazards. Our technicians are trained to work efficiently and effectively, ensuring the job is done quickly and thoroughly.
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, we'll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area, preventing further damage and mold growth.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ure the area is completely dry and safe for you and your family to return to.
Restoration and Repair
Finally, our team will work to restore your floors to their original condition, using spec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the job is done right. We'll repair any damaged flooring, replace any damaged materials, and leave your home looking like new.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Ontario, CA
The cost of flo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ontario, CA. That being said, here are some estimated price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 - $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 - $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 - $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ed |
